Last summer I spent three wonderful months on travelling in Georgia, Iran and Turkey; during this trip I met hundreds of really amazing people, and although the video does not show my social adventures, I assure you that the people in those three countries are amazingly lovely: friendly, helpful, caring, hospitable, with HUGE hearts!! And, here I would like to say big "thank you" to all of them I have met (though probably few of them will read it..)
My only means of transport was autostop (hitchhiking), I just packed my stuff and left my flat in Poland, immediately hitting the road; on my way to the East and back I crossed such countries as Czech Republic, Slovakia, Austria, Hungary, Slovenia, Croatia, Greece, Serbia, Macedonia, Romania and Bulgaria.
Since I don't have a regular job, people often ask me how I can manage to get enough money for such long and complex trip, well, my answer is: "the more money you have, the more difficult travelling becomes" (for me travelling is a completely different thing from "touristing"). And so, my budget is never too big - at least if I become a target of robbers, I have nothing to lose ;))
